Magnetic Poles

The science concepts/standards for this lesson are:

  • Magnets have 2 ends called poles (North {positive} and South {negative}).
  • Opposite poles attract (pull closer) each other (N an S).
  • Like poles repel (move away from) each other (N and N) (S and S).


Materials Needed 
  • 2 magnets (per child or group)



Opposite Poles Attract



  


   
Like Poles Repel
  1. Give the kids 2 magnets and time to "play", observe, and discover with the magnets.
  2. Ask the children what they observed and discovered from "playing" with the magnets.
  3. Have the children predict (or recall) what happens when 2 opposite poles are pushed together. Have the kids push 2 opposite poles together. Then have them try to pull the opposite poles apart. The magnetic forces between the magnets will be holding them together.
  4. Have the children explain what happens when 2 opposite poles are pushed together
  5. Have the kids predict (or recall) what happens when 2 identical poles are pushed together. Have the kids try to push 2 identical poles together. They will feel the magnetic forces pushing the magnets apart.
  6. Have the children explain what happens when 2 identical poles are pushed together.

    Static Electricity and Balloons

    Static Electricity Balloon Demonstration

    Vocabulary: positive charges, negative charges, attract (to move close together), repel (to move away)



    Materials: 2 balloons, 2 pieces of string, (piece of wool - optional)

    An object generally has the same number of positive and negative charges.
    An object can lose negative charges and thus become positively charged.
    • When 2 positively charged objects are brought close to each other they will REPEL each other. (The same will happen to 2 negatively charged objects.)
    • When a positively charged object is brought close to a negatively charged object they will ATTRACT each other.
    This can be demonstrated with 2 balloons each tied to a piece of string.

    Try rubbing a balloon(s) with a piece of wool. This will remove negative charges from the wool and add them to the balloon(s) making the balloon(s) negatively charged.

    Give the kids time to experiment and work with the balloons as they try to make the balloons attract and repel each other.



    After the activity, children can sketch and label pictures of the balloons attracting and repelling in their science notebooks

    Older students can write a summary explaining what causes the balloons to attract or repel.
